Parkinson's Disease Resource List
This brand new 100-page comprehensive print guide includes over 650 community resources throughout the US and around the world. The resources included in the guide address many of the needs that may arise for a person living with Parkinson's disease. It also includes sections geared specifically toward those with early-onset PD, the newly diagnosed, caregivers and more. Resources listed include: national and local Parkinson's groups; movement disorder centers; financial, insurance and legal planning assistance; clinical trials; medical equipment; caregiver-specific resources; personal stories. Deep Brain Stimulation for Parkinson’s Disease (Third Edition)
This 40-page booklet discusses deep brain stimulation (DBS), the most common surgery performed to treat Parkinson's disease (PD). It reviews the history of DBS, discusses the procedures currently available, and advises people with Parkinson's both how to prepare for surgery and how to maintain their health post-surgery. It also asesses risks of DBS, answers frequently-asked questions , including "Who is a good candidate for surgery?" - and discusses the future of surgery for PD.

Building Patient Trust
This report summarizes the proceeding and findings of a 2007 roundtable discussion that explored barriers to clinical research: specifically how the Parkinson’s community can improve patient trust in the process. Participants included people with Parkinson’s, researchers, industry representatives and members of government.
